Output 17d973af12580a6eab262ff62bc29d3217f8641e6df2a9888d1dc60f6036e62a:0

value
32069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243501b3865f5f45c0e3ee8377bd6640f0014ebe OP_EQUAL
address
34zTkR5WdnScXJi6A9pQFgbjbYbBZh8sM9
transaction
17d973af12580a6eab262ff62bc29d3217f8641e6df2a9888d1dc60f6036e62a
spent
true